the original movie is the only one that's really good, the rest are fine but not really on that level
The first one is kind of special in that it still had most of the late 80s cyberpunk vibe, almost entirely traditionally animated and had great writing and direction.
The two later iterations were good as well, but had lost that vibe and vividness, generally everything depicted felt less alive.
The two SAC series were good but could easily have had their plotlines condensed to two thirds their length without losing anything important.

Big EH to that.
The mangos are very different, same for pretty much all of Masamune Shirovs animu adaptions. As much GITS animu as there is you'd think the manga is some large piece of work, but actually there's not all that much of it, and fully half of it is the author crawling up his own ass with technobabble. The Arise series and later is just the author doing a cashgrab after spending all his hentai artbook money on hookers and blow, basically written for Netflix.

The one that stayed truest to the manga source is probably the Dominion Tank Police OVA series, which incidentally is fucking great.
Hueg glam metal hair, cyborg catgirls in leotards, lowbrow humour and action.
